Output ec12e7531cfae03cb4b206eb59769de117db27fd2508fb45b6334f6d106b73a6:21

value
5501809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44dee34aa8f5e697b771a33b39d66597a3c36f6f OP_EQUAL
address
37yAt7DsXmzPZD6JAUuSCcmavZZHm66Hum
transaction
ec12e7531cfae03cb4b206eb59769de117db27fd2508fb45b6334f6d106b73a6
spent
true